de·rive ( P ) Pronunciation Key (d-rv)
v. de·rived, de·riv·ing, de·rives
v. tr.
To obtain or receive from a source.
To arrive at by reasoning; deduce or infer: derive a conclusion from facts.
To trace the origin or development of (a word).
Linguistics. To generate (a surface structure) from a deep structure.
Chemistry. To produce or obtain (a compound) from another substance by chemical reaction.
